The iconic anime series One Piece has officially entered its long-awaited [Elbaph Arc|location] as of April 5, 2026.
Under this new production model, Toei Animation aims to deliver higher-quality animation by capping the series at 26 episodes per year, ensuring the adaptation stays faithful to the manga's pacing during this [Final Saga|narrative].
Elbaph, the legendary land of the giants, has been teased since the earliest days of the series, making this arrival a dream come true for characters like Luffy and Usopp.
The arc promises significant lore reveals, including deep dives into Norse-inspired world-building, the mystery of the Will of D, and high-stakes political tension as the World Government attempts to intervene.
